Home to host Hamster vs Human Dance-Off tomorrow


We don't know what else to say. Looks like someone at the PlayStation Home team finally snapped? (Also, does the Stay Puft Marshmallow Man count as a human? Just wondering about the technicalities here.)

Guess we'll see you in Home Central Plaza tomorrow at 8PM PST?

This article was originally published on Joystiq.